Latency and Connection Quality Issues
Australian users typically experience 150-250ms latency when connecting to servers in Europe and North America. This delay is noticeable in conversation but does not prevent meaningful video chat experiences.
Modern platforms have improved their infrastructure to accommodate longer-distance connections. Video quality adaptive algorithms help maintain smooth video despite latency challenges.
Australian Online Safety Act Considerations
The Online Safety Act 2021 creates framework for regulating online services including video chat platforms. Platforms serving Australian users must implement age verification and content reporting mechanisms.
Reputable platforms comply with Australian requirements, providing reporting tools and moderation. This creates a safer environment but means some platforms may restrict certain features for Australian users.

Time Zone Considerations
Australian time zones (AEST, ACST, AWST) significantly affect when users can find active connections. Evening hours (7pm-11pm AEST) align with late afternoon in Europe and early morning in the Americas.
Weekend afternoons typically offer the best combination of domestic users and international connections. Weekday evenings tend to be quieter but still provide meaningful interaction opportunities.
